This is the 21st Coville book and I think it is the most enjoyable. It is not new (1992) but I recently saw it sitting on a book store shelf. One of the characters name is Ishmael. When he is asked his name he says it is Ishmael, but don't call me that. Throughout the book when his name is mentioned people say - don't call him that. This is a fun story build along high fantasy's classic lines. The "note from the author" at the end explains why it is so good. He has lived with the story for a while and just recently decided to get it published. Be sure to get this one for your fantasy and/or Coville lovers.
